The Powers RL 243 MP Multi-Purpose Relay is a pneumatic auxiliary device designed to
provide a variety of pneumatic control functions for the typical control system.
Applications include direct and reverse acting amplifying, signal advancing, minimum
pressure relay, and lower pressure transfer. (See Figures 2 through 10.)
The relay operates on a force balance principal and is provided with a Powers two-valve
design to assure stability and prevent unnecessary air consumption. Internal relief
assembly prevents signal lock-up and assures fail-safe operation. The relay housing is
provided with integral brackets to facilitate installation without a separate bracket.
A single spring adjustment is provided to allow setting the relay for desired operation.
The relay is adaptable for flush panel mounting to facilitate manual readjustment if
desired.

The relay output pressure at port R is dependent upon the adjustable setting of spring
S1, the interaction of pneumatic signals at ports TD and TR, and the availability of a
supply source at port S. The basic relay formula can be expressed as follows:
